YouTube’s server-side ad insertion complicates ad blocking efforts
YouTube has come up with a fresh tactic to hamstring ad blockers — incorporating ads directly into the video content itself through a method called “server-side ad insertion.” This approach substantially complicates the task of ad blockers in detecting and blocking ads. A hacker recently advertised selling a database allegedly stolen from the e-commerce giant Shopify. However, the company says the archives did not come from its systems, but rather a third party. The UK’s National Health Service (NHS) is at risk of even more devastating cyberattacks, since parts of its IT infrastructure are outdated.
